Commercial Description:
A traditional full-bodied stout brewed with lactose (milk sugar). The subtle sweetness imparted by the lactose balances the sharpness of the highly roasted grains which give this delicious beer its black color.

Bottle, BB 11/06. Head is initially average sized, frothy/fizzy, light brown, mostly lasting. Body is dark brown. Aroma is moderately malty (chocolate milk, roasted grain, molasses), trace hops (resin), with notes of berries, minerals, vanilla, leather, ashes. Flavor is moderately sweet, lightly acidic, lightly bitter. Finish is lightly to moderately sweet, lightly acidic, lightly to moderately bitter. Medium body, creamy texture, lively carbonation. Quite delightful for the style, even though it’s not one I can get excited about (one of my least favorite stout substyles). Very intriguing nose and a pleasant mouthfeel.

12 oz bottle. Clear ebony with a crema head. Settles to a skin. Nose of sour cream and brown bread. Traces of smoke and licorice. Starts with a nice tang of sour apple. Silky body melts over the tongue leaving cream soda and dark chocolate. Aftertaste like a coffee, regular. Wonderfully drinkable for a stout. Like a cocoa at bedtime.
